Consolidated feedback

Also called: consolidated notes

ELI5

One coordinated set of notes representing the relevant decision-makers instead of conflicting comments arriving separately.

Used in conversation

“Please send consolidated feedback instead of separate, conflicting notes from five people.”

Definition

One coordinated set of notes representing the relevant decision-makers rather than conflicting comments arriving separately.
